What is the statute of limitations for personal injury cases in Louisiana?

In most Louisiana personal injury cases, you have one year from the date of the injury to file a lawsuit. This deadline is shorter than in many other states. Claims involving government entities may require additional notice and even shorter timelines. Missing the deadline can permanently bar recovery.

What if my injury happened on someone else’s property?

If you were injured on another person’s property, Louisiana law may allow you to pursue a premises liability claim. Property owners have a duty to address unsafe conditions or provide warnings. Liability depends on factors such as the hazard involved, notice, and the reason you were on the property.

Can I recover damages for pain and suffering in Louisiana?

Yes. Louisiana law allows injured individuals to seek compensation for p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of enjoyment of life. These non-economic damages are evaluated based on the nature of the injury, recovery time, and how the injury affects daily life.
